Output dac5cd96659224a91848a94eb4cdb2e0f38b82b3e1069c2a0a8269f9f50fe59e:18

value
6700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c3b92a377c27f4694e1d3d2ef437e172135654d OP_EQUAL
address
AB49siPFiTvAfhUSgTe4Qkw3Y1eJZpFmLh
transaction
dac5cd96659224a91848a94eb4cdb2e0f38b82b3e1069c2a0a8269f9f50fe59e